Story
We are pleased to say that, after discussions with East Midlands Ambulance Service (EMAS), the Mapperley Cooperative Store and Gedling Borough Council, plans are now in place for a potentially life saving device to be available for the general public visiting the busy commercial area of Mapperley Top in Nottingham.
Physio Control is the largest manufacturer of resuscitation devices in the world and have been established since 1955. 70% of the ambulance services have Physio Control on board their ambulances or in the hospitals so it is proven technology.
The offer: East Midlands Ambulance Service is currently running a promotion that means we can obtain a defibrillator, external cabinet and training for up to 2 hours.
The LIFEPAK® CR Plus defibrillator comes with 2 x Pair of Quickpak electrodes, a CHARGE-PAK Charge Stick, Soft carry case, resuscitation kit and a Training DVD.
See more information at Physio Control
The cost of the device including VAT is 1188.80 and ongoing replacement parts (over the 8 year warranty) will be 268.20. The total being £1457.
The cabinet will require an electrician to fit to an external wall. Maybe a local electrician will provide this service for free.
All we need now is to fund this with a target amount of £1500.
